public class DescriptorEventManagerWrapper
extends org.eclipse.persistence.descriptors.DescriptorEventManager
implements java.lang.Cloneable, java.io.Serializable
| Modifier and Type | Field and Description |
|---|---|
protected org.eclipse.persistence.descriptors.DescriptorEventManager |
delegate |
AboutToDeleteEvent, AboutToInsertEvent, AboutToUpdateEvent, defaultEventListeners, descriptor, descriptorEventHolders, entityEventListener, entityEventManagers, entityListenerEventListeners, entityListenerEventManagers, eventListeners, eventMethods, eventSelectors, excludeDefaultListeners, excludeSuperclassListeners, hasAnyEventListeners, internalListeners, NumberOfEvents, PostBuildEvent, PostCloneEvent, PostDeleteEvent, PostInsertEvent, PostMergeEvent, PostRefreshEvent, PostUpdateEvent, PostWriteEvent, PreDeleteEvent, PreInsertEvent, PrePersistEvent, PreRemoveEvent, PreUpdateEvent, PreUpdateWithChangesEvent, PreWriteEvent| Constructor and Description |
|---|
DescriptorEventManagerWrapper(org.eclipse.persistence.descriptors.DescriptorEventManager delegate) |
| Modifier and Type | Method and Description |
|---|---|
void |
addDefaultEventList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ener) |
void |
addEntityListenerEventList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ener) |
void |
addEntityListenerHolder(org.eclipse.persistence.descriptors.SerializableDescriptorEventHolder holder) |
void |
addInternalList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ener) |
void |
addList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ener) |
java.lang.Object |
clone() |
boolean |
excludeDefaultListeners() |
boolean |
excludeSuperclassListeners() |
void |
executeEvent(org.eclipse.persistence.descriptors.DescriptorEvent event) |
java.lang.String |
getAboutToDeleteSelector() |
java.lang.String |
getAboutToInsertSelector() |
java.lang.String |
getAboutToUpdateSelector() |
java.util.List<org.eclipse.persistence.descriptors.DescriptorEventListener> |
getDefaultEventListeners() |
java.util.List<org.eclipse.persistence.descriptors.SerializableDescriptorEventHolder> |
getDescriptorEventHolders() |
org.eclipse.persistence.descriptors.DescriptorEventListener |
getEntityEventListener() |
java.util.List<org.eclipse.persistence.descriptors.DescriptorEventListener> |
getEntityListenerEventListeners() |
java.util.List<org.eclipse.persistence.descriptors.DescriptorEventListener> |
getEventListeners() |
java.lang.String |
getPostBuildSelector() |
java.lang.String |
getPostCloneSelector() |
java.lang.String |
getPostDeleteSelector() |
java.lang.String |
getPostInsertSelector() |
java.lang.String |
getPostMergeSelector() |
java.lang.String |
getPostRefreshSelector() |
java.lang.String |
getPostUpdateSelector() |
java.lang.String |
getPostWriteSelector() |
java.lang.String |
getPreDeleteSelector() |
java.lang.String |
getPreInsertSelector() |
java.lang.String |
getPrePersistSelector() |
java.lang.String |
getPreRemoveSelector() |
java.lang.String |
getPreUpdateSelector() |
java.lang.String |
getPreWriteSelector() |
boolean |
hasAnyEventListeners() |
boolean |
hasDefaultEventListeners() |
boolean |
hasEntityEventListener() |
boolean |
hasEntityListenerEventListeners() |
boolean |
hasInternalEventListeners() |
void |
initialize(org.eclipse.persistence.internal.sessions.AbstractSession session) |
void |
notifyListeners(org.eclipse.persistence.descriptors.DescriptorEvent event) |
void |
processDescriptorEventHolders(org.eclipse.persistence.internal.sessions.AbstractSession session,
java.lang.ClassLoader classLoader) |
void |
remoteInitialization(org.eclipse.persistence.internal.sessions.AbstractSession session) |
void |
removeList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ener) |
void |
setAboutToDeleteSelector(java.lang.String aboutToDeleteSelector) |
void |
setAboutToInsertSelector(java.lang.String aboutToInsertSelector) |
void |
setAboutToUpdateSelector(java.lang.String aboutToUpdateSelector) |
void |
setDescriptor(org.eclipse.persistence.descriptors.ClassDescriptor descriptor) |
void |
setDescriptorEventHolders(java.util.List<org.eclipse.persistence.descriptors.SerializableDescriptorEventHolder> descriptorEventHolders) |
void |
setEntityEventList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ener) |
void |
setExcludeDefaultListeners(boolean excludeDefaultListeners) |
void |
setExcludeSuperclassListeners(boolean excludeSuperclassListeners) |
void |
setPostBuildSelector(java.lang.String postBuildSelector) |
void |
setPostCloneSelector(java.lang.String postCloneSelector) |
void |
setPostDeleteSelector(java.lang.String postDeleteSelector) |
void |
setPostInsertSelector(java.lang.String postInsertSelector) |
void |
setPostMergeSelector(java.lang.String postMergeSelector) |
void |
setPostRefreshSelector(java.lang.String postRefreshSelector) |
void |
setPostUpdateSelector(java.lang.String postUpdateSelector) |
void |
setPostWriteSelector(java.lang.String postWriteSelector) |
void |
setPreDeleteSelector(java.lang.String preDeleteSelector) |
void |
setPreInsertSelector(java.lang.String preInsertSelector) |
void |
setPrePersistSelector(java.lang.String prePersistSelector) |
void |
setPreRemoveSelector(java.lang.String preRemoveSelector) |
void |
setPreUpdateSelector(java.lang.String preUpdateSelector) |
void |
setPreWriteSelector(java.lang.String preWriteSelector) |
findMethod, getDescriptor, getEventMethods, getEventSelectors, hasAnyListeners, initializeEJB30EventManagers, notifyEJB30Listeners, notifyListener, setEventListeners, setEventMethods, setEventSelectors, setHasAnyEventListenersprotected final org.eclipse.persistence.descriptors.DescriptorEventManager delegate
public DescriptorEventManagerWrapper(org.eclipse.persistence.descriptors.DescriptorEventManager delegate)
public void notifyListeners(org.eclipse.persistence.descriptors.DescriptorEvent event)
notifyList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void remoteInitialization(org.eclipse.persistence.internal.sessions.AbstractSession session)
remoteInitialization in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void removeList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ener)
removeListener in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setAboutToDeleteSelector(java.lang.String aboutToDeleteSelector)
setAboutToDelete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setAboutToInsertSelector(java.lang.String aboutToInsertSelector)
setAboutToInsertS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setAboutToUpdateSelector(java.lang.String aboutToUpdateSelector)
setAboutToUpdateS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setDescriptor(org.eclipse.persistence.descriptors.ClassDescriptor descriptor)
setDescriptor in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setEntityEventList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ener)
setEntityEventListener in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setExcludeDefaultListeners(boolean excludeDefaultListeners)
setExcludeDefaultList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setExcludeSuperclassListeners(boolean excludeSuperclassListeners)
setExcludeSuperclassList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PostBuildSelector(java.lang.String postBuildSelector)
setPostBuildS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PostCloneSelector(java.lang.String postCloneSelector)
setPostCloneS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PostDeleteSelector(java.lang.String postDeleteSelector)
setPostDelete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PostInsertSelector(java.lang.String postInsertSelector)
setPostInsertS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PostMergeSelector(java.lang.String postMergeSelector)
setPostMergeS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PostRefreshSelector(java.lang.String postRefreshSelector)
setPostRefreshS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PostUpdateSelector(java.lang.String postUpdateSelector)
setPostUpdateS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PostWriteSelector(java.lang.String postWriteSelector)
setPostWrite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PreDeleteSelector(java.lang.String preDeleteSelector)
setPreDelete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PreInsertSelector(java.lang.String preInsertSelector)
setPreInsertS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PrePersistSelector(java.lang.String prePersistSelector)
setPrePersistS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PreRemoveSelector(java.lang.String preRemoveSelector)
setPreRemoveS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PreUpdateSelector(java.lang.String preUpdateSelector)
setPreUpdateS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setPreWriteSelector(java.lang.String preWriteSelector)
setPreWrite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void addDefaultEventList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ener)
addDefaultEventListener in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void addEntityListenerEventList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ener)
addEntityListenerEventListener in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void addList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ener)
addListener in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void addInternalListener(org.eclipse.persistence.descriptors.DescriptorEventListener listener)
addInternalListener in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void addEntityListenerHolder(org.eclipse.persistence.descriptors.SerializableDescriptorEventHolder holder)
addEntityListenerHolder in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.Object clone()
clone in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void processDescriptorEventHolders(org.eclipse.persistence.internal.sessions.AbstractSession session,
java.lang.ClassLoader classLoader)
processDescriptorEventHolders in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ic boolean excludeDefaultListeners()
excludeDefaultList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ic boolean excludeSuperclassListeners()
excludeSuperclassList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void executeEvent(org.eclipse.persistence.descriptors.DescriptorEvent event)
throws org.eclipse.persistence.exceptions.DescriptorException
executeEvent in class org.eclipse.persistence.descriptors.DescriptorEventManagerorg.eclipse.persistence.exceptions.DescriptorExceptionpublic java.lang.String getAboutToDeleteSelector()
getAboutToDelete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getAboutToInsertSelector()
getAboutToInsertS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getAboutToUpdateSelector()
getAboutToUpdateS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.util.List<org.eclipse.persistence.descriptors.DescriptorEventListener> getDefaultEventListeners()
getDefaultEventList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.util.List<org.eclipse.persistence.descriptors.SerializableDescriptorEventHolder> getDescriptorEventHolders()
getDescriptorEventHolders in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void setDescriptorEventHolders(java.util.List<org.eclipse.persistence.descriptors.SerializableDescriptorEventHolder> descriptorEventHolders)
setDescriptorEventHolders in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ic org.eclipse.persistence.descriptors.DescriptorEventListener getEntityEventListener()
getEntityEventListener in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.util.List<org.eclipse.persistence.descriptors.DescriptorEventListener> getEntityListenerEventListeners()
getEntityListenerEventList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.util.List<org.eclipse.persistence.descriptors.DescriptorEventListener> getEventListeners()
getEventList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PostBuildSelector()
getPostBuildS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PostCloneSelector()
getPostCloneS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PostDeleteSelector()
getPostDelete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PostInsertSelector()
getPostInsertS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PostMergeSelector()
getPostMergeS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PostRefreshSelector()
getPostRefreshS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PostUpdateSelector()
getPostUpdateS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PostWriteSelector()
getPostWrite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PrePersistSelector()
getPrePersistS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PreDeleteSelector()
getPreDelete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PreInsertSelector()
getPreInsertS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PreRemoveSelector()
getPreRemoveS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PreUpdateSelector()
getPreUpdateS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ic java.lang.String getPreWriteSelector()
getPreWriteSelector in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ic boolean hasAnyEventListeners()
hasAnyEventList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ic boolean hasDefaultEventListeners()
hasDefaultEventList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ic boolean hasEntityEventListener()
hasEntityEventListener in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ic boolean hasInternalEventListeners()
hasInternalEventList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ic boolean hasEntityListenerEventListeners()
hasEntityListenerEventListeners in class org.eclipse.persistence.descriptors.DescriptorEventManagerpublic void initialize(org.eclipse.persistence.internal.sessions.AbstractSession session)
initialize in class org.eclipse.persistence.descriptors.DescriptorEventManager